The installation time for a sidewalk or pathway in Andover can vary based on several factors, including the material chosen and the complexity of the design. Generally, a straightforward concrete sidewalk can be installed within a couple of days, including the time for curing. More intricate designs using pavers or bricks may take longer, possibly up to a week or more, depending on the size and layout. Weather conditions in Andover can also impact the timeline; for instance, rain or extreme temperatures may delay work. Consulting with a local contractor can provide a more accurate estimate based on your specific project details and local conditions.

The average cost of sidewalk installation in Andover varies based on materials, size, and complexity of the design. Typically, homeowners can expect to pay between $8 to $15 per square foot for concrete sidewalks, while brick or paver installations may range from $10 to $25 per square foot. Factors such as site preparation, grading, and drainage solutions can also influence overall costs. Obtaining quotes from multiple local contractors is advisable to compare prices and services. In Andover, various materials are commonly used for sidewalk and pathway installation, including concrete, brick, pavers, and natural stone. Concrete is often the preferred choice for its durability and low maintenance, making it suitable for high-traffic areas. Brick and pavers offer aesthetic appeal and flexibility in design but may require more maintenance over time. Natural stone provides a unique look and can enhance the landscape, although it tends to be more expensive. When choosing materials, consider your budget, the intended use of the walkway, and how well the materials will withstand Andover's weather conditions.
